Secret of Mana is a colorful action RPG from Squaresoft directed by Koichi Ishii, produced by Hiromichi Tanaka, with music by Hiroki Kikuta. The game follows a trio of young heroes as they team together to charge the Mana Sword before an evil empire can resurrect the Mana Fortress.
This game is a 1993 release from Squaresoft for the Super Nintendo and is actually the second game in the Seiken Densetsu series. The first was released in the US as the Game Boy title Final Fantasy Adventure. Seiken Densetsu 3 was also released on the Super Famicom in Japan but never saw a release outside of that region, and Secret of Evermore was developed by the US branch of Squaresoft in an attempt to make up for this.
The SoM series is famous for its Ring Command menu system. When the menu is brought up, it appears as a ring over the currently selected player character. These rings can be navigated to select magic, use items, equip weapons and armor, set options, and look up statistics on character development. Also of note is the game's multiplayer aspect, letting additional players drop in and out to control the other characters in real-time combat.
The iOS and Android versions are enhanced ports that feature bug-fixes, a retranslated script, a modified control system to work with a touchscreen, and updated visuals, but in the process the multiplayer aspect was lost.
